The Mystery of Volcanoes: The Biggest Eruption in History Volcanoes are often easily associated with frightening historical records. Among the various eruptive events, several events stand out as the most significant. One of them is the eruption of Mount Tambora in Indonesia in 1815. With a VEI (Volcanic Explosivity Index) scale of 7, this eruption not only changed the local landscape, but also had a global impact. The smoke and dust released caused a “year without a summer” in many parts of the world, triggering crop failures, famine and migration. Another frequently discussed mystery is the Krakatau volcano, also in Indonesia, which erupted in 1883. This eruption produced devastating tsunami waves that could be heard up to 4,800 kilometers away. The effects of the Krakatoa eruption were felt as far away as Europe, with the sky filled with volcanic particles which caused an extraordinary sky color phenomenon. From a scientific perspective, this eruption is a topic of in-depth research to understand the behavior of volcanoes. One method used is computer modeling to estimate the impact of an eruption. Meanwhile, geological observations focus on signs of volcanic activity such as earthquakes, ground deformation and gas emissions. The mystery of volcanoes is also the embodiment of natural forces. Behind the splendor and beauty of volcanoes lies danger that continues to lurk. Residents living around risk areas need to have an effective early warning system. Various mitigation strategies have been developed to reduce risks, including hazard maps and public education. The existence of volcanoes not only provides threats, but also benefits. The land around volcanoes is often very fertile, supporting agriculture. Additionally, geothermal activity around volcanoes creates a renewable energy source. It must be remembered that knowledge about volcanic behavior continues to develop. Scientists are now focusing on developing new technologies in monitoring and analysis, such as drones and advanced sensors. This gives hope that the community can be much better prepared to deal with eruptions that may occur in the future. In Indonesia, with more than 130 active volcanoes, the presence of these mountains is an inseparable part of people’s identity. People often have beliefs and myths related to volcanoes, which adds a cultural dimension to understanding this phenomenon.
